Core Functionality
A valve lifter’s primary role is to eliminate valve lash – the small clearance between the camshaft and the valve stem. By doing so, it guarantees that valves open and close at precisely the intended moments, preserving engine timing and performance.
- Hydraulic Operation: The LUK lifter uses a built‑in hydraulic chamber to absorb minor variations in cam profile or wear, ensuring smooth valve movement.
- Pressure Regulation: It maintains a constant pressure of approximately 0.5–1 bar (7–15 psi) against the valve stem, preventing excessive lift while allowing full closure when required.
- Self‑Adjusting: As engine components wear, the lifter automatically compensates by adjusting its internal spring tension, extending service life and reducing maintenance intervals.

Maintenance & Troubleshooting
While the lifter is designed for long‑term reliability, certain symptoms may indicate wear or malfunction:
- Engine Knock or Rattle: Often caused by excessive valve lash; check for worn lifters.
- Reduced Power Output: May signal a stuck or leaking hydraulic chamber.
- Oil Consumption Increase: Could be due to oil leakage into the lifter’s hydraulic system.
Regular engine oil changes with high‑quality synthetic oils help maintain optimal lifter performance. If issues arise, replace the affected lifters promptly to avoid further damage to the camshaft or valve train.
